Title:
HONEYCOMB ROTOR FOR ANTIVIRAL, ANTIBACTERIAL AIR-CONDITIONING

Abstract:
To provide an air-conditioning honeycomb rotor having the effect of reducing an increased risk of secondary infection with un-predicted spreading of virus and a bacterium in a general facility such as a waiting room of an elder care facility, a hospital, a school, a public facility, or a commercial facility such as a cruise vessel and a hotel, with a minimum increase of cost.SOLUTION: The present invention pertains to an air-conditioning honeycomb rotor of a size equal to or smaller than a suitable diameter (an equivalent diameter) less than 1/2 of a rotor width (a flow passage length) such that a run-up section until an Re number of an airflow in the honeycomb becomes a laminar-flow area less than 2300 and inflow air completely becomes a laminar flow, even at a designed amount of maximum air. The air-conditioning honeycomb rotor is covered with a coating layer containing antibacterial agent of copper ion elution type on a sheet surface constituting the honeycomb.SELECTED DRAWING: Figure 2
